Rafe wrote: > While looking at the USB resume problem (had it here, too), > I found that compiling a kernel with "option USB_DEBUG", > then enabling kernel debug messages on uhci with > "sysctl hw.usb.uhci.debug=1" brings USB back every time. Thanks for the hint - I just rebuilt the kernel and tested this. Unfurtunable, it does not change the behavior on my machine. I think this has something to do with the fact that the OS in my case does not recognise the resume because it is a a BIOS function with APM disabled.
